Grabbe Name Meaning

North German: variant of Krabbe .

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

What did your Grabbe 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er and Housewife were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Grabbe. 34% of Grabbe men worked as a Farmer and 36% of Grabbe women worked as a Housewife. Some less common occupations for Americans named Grabbe were Manager and House Cleaner. .

What is the average Grabbe lifespan?

Between 1948 and 2004, in the United States, Grabbe life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1966, and highest in 2000. The average life expectancy for Grabbe in 1948 was 66, and 83 in 2004.
